Remembering what we did before we had voicemail come around is not an easy thing to recall. It seems like we have always had voicemail. Before however, we had to depend on answering machines to get the job done. If we had misses a message for whatever reason the answering machine had to do the job of saving it for us.

Before we had answering machines or voicemail you would have to hope that the person you were trying to get in touch with was home. If they weren’t they would never even know that you had called. There was no way to leave any sort of message for them.

Devices like these that allow for you to leave messages for people are however a necessary evil. People can’t be by their phones every hour of every day. The convenience of voice mail and answering machines goes both ways. It’s convenient for both the person leaving the message as well as the person receiving it.

Just because leaving messages and making voicemail recordings has been around for a while doesn’t mean that people don’t make mistakes. A quick lesson in voicemail etiquette is good for everyone to have.

Don’t be one of those people that over thinks leaving a message on someone’s voicemail. It’s not rocket science and doesn’t need to be taken that seriously. Leaving a message that is just short and to the point is perfectly find. Just please don’t hang up on someone’s voicemail. That can be very annoying.

Many people think that if something is important enough, you will call back, and therefore may not call you back unless you have left a voice mail.

If you find that your friends or colleagues rarely leave messages, take a few minutes to listen to your outgoing message.

An outgoing message should be short and to the point, so that others quickly know that they reached the right person.

If you are tempted to create a funny or cute outgoing message, think this through very carefully. The novelty of this wore off years ago.
